Highlights
Are people in Covina older or younger than people in Walnut?
- The Median Age in Covina is 8.2 years younger than in Walnut.

Are housing costs cheaper in Covina or Walnut?
- Covina housing costs are 37.9% less expensive than Walnut hous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Covina or Walnut?
- The average commute for residents of Covina is 2.5 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Walnut.

Things to do in Covina?
Covina, California is a vibrant community in Los Angeles County with a population of about 50,000 people. There are many fun things to do here like checking out live music at the Covina Bowl or exploring outdoor activities like biking and hiking trails. For shopping, you can explore local stores in the historic downtown area or find something unique at one of the nearby malls or big box stores. Covina also has plenty of restaurants offering delicious international cuisine plus entertainment centers with movie theaters, laser tag arenas and bowling alleys.
